Progress in tackling corruption across the EU has stalled over the past decade. The regions average score in the 2025 CPI has declined from 66 to 64, highlighting a widening gap between anti-corruption standards, their enforcement, and the integrity of those in power. Transparency International, together with our Brussels office Transparency International EU, are pleased to submit feedback on the draft Implementing Regulation on the formats for the submission of beneficial ownership information to the Member States central registers.
Transparency International EU (TI EU) believes that the ongoing evolution of the EU Anti-Fraud Architecture (AFA) presents a crucial opportunity to strengthen the protection of the Unions financial interests through greater cooperation, and institutional coherence between key anti-fraud actors, notably the European Public Prosecutors Office (EPPO) and the European Anti-Fraud Office (OLAF).
